【cv和cs是什么意思】在计算机科学和技术领域,经常会看到“CV”和“CS”这两个缩写。它们分别代表不同的概念,但在实际应用中经常被混淆。本文将对这两个术语进行简要解释,并通过表格形式进行对比总结。
一、CV(Computer Vision)的含义
CV是“Computer Vision”的缩写,中文译为“计算机视觉”。它是一门研究如何让计算机“看懂”图像或视频的学科,属于人工智能的一个重要分支。CV技术广泛应用于人脸识别、物体检测、自动驾驶、医学影像分析等多个领域。
核心功能包括:
- 图像识别
- 目标检测
- 图像分割
- 3D重建
- 视频分析
二、CS(Computer Science)的含义
CS是“Computer Science”的缩写,即“计算机科学”。它是一门研究计算机系统、算法、数据结构、软件开发等基础理论与应用的学科。CS是整个信息技术领域的基石,涵盖了从硬件到软件的广泛内容。
主要研究方向包括:
- 算法设计与分析
- 数据结构
- 操作系统
- 编程语言
- 软件工程
- 人工智能
三、CV与CS的区别与联系
虽然CV和CS都属于计算机相关领域,但它们的研究重点和应用场景有明显不同。CV更偏向于图像处理和模式识别,而CS则是一个更为广泛的学科,涵盖计算机系统的各个方面。
| 项目 | CV(Computer Vision) | CS(Computer Science) |
| 全称 | Computer Vision | Computer Science |
| 中文名称 | 计算机视觉 | 计算机科学 |
| 研究方向 | 图像处理、目标识别、视频分析 | 算法、数据结构、操作系统、编程语言等 |
| 应用领域 | 人脸识别、自动驾驶、医学影像分析 | 软件开发、系统设计、网络安全等 |
| 技术依赖 | 图像处理、深度学习、神经网络 | 算法设计、编程、数据库等 |
| 与AI关系 | 是AI的重要分支之一 | 是AI的基础学科 |
四、总结
CV和CS虽然在名称上相似,但所指代的内容完全不同。CV专注于图像和视频的分析与理解,而CS则是关于计算机整体系统的理论与实践。在实际工作中,两者常常相互结合,例如在开发智能摄像头系统时,既需要CS的基础知识,也需要CV的技术支持。
如果你在学习或工作中遇到这两个术语,了解它们的定义和区别是非常重要的。希望本文能帮助你更好地理解CV和CS的含义。


